The arrest of Shelley Sue Diaz
Flatt died on July 2 when the motorcycle he was riding was struck by a car in the 1200 block of East Silver Springs Boulevard.
Ocala police said the vehicle s driver, Shelley Sue Diaz of Ocala, was trying to cross Silver Springs Boulevard, at Northeast 12th Terrace, when the car and Flatt s motorcycle collided.
Flatt was thrown from the bike and pronounced deceased on the sidewalk. Officers said he was speeding at the time of the crash. Flatt was 43.
An officer arrested Diaz on a charge of DUI manslaughter after she reportedly failed a field sobriety exercise administered not long after the crash. She spent four days at a local hospital for observation and then was released.
